Output fe4c95f94b49a6689081d4733e5cabb659303c90f4b67182481e075b9626c191:1

value
26276068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a253c82176537d989aa8d94e361f229e543505 OP_EQUAL
address
3CR1Sgf2gxwfTjJM3NKELmyvxk9X9BLLjY
transaction
fe4c95f94b49a6689081d4733e5cabb659303c90f4b67182481e075b9626c191
spent
true